I can't believe I'm saying this, but I think Benitez is the leading candidate:
- Title with Tenerife (don't know how impressive this is, to be honest)
- 2 La Liga titles with Valencia (first title in 31 years)
- UEFA Cup, FA Cup & Champions League with Liverpool...Liverpool!
- Realising Gerrard is not a central midfielder (certainly not in a 4-4-2) and converting him into a brilliant right winger
- Buying 3 genuinely world class players in Mascherano, Alonso and Torres
- Understanding the importance of ball retention in midfield - Mascherano and Alonso
- In theory, being Spanish should be a massive advantage with the wealth of Spanish talent out there
I know he bought a lot of dross (notably Keane and arguably Aquilani), but there were some other good signings aside from the above, like Reina (?ú6M), Garcia (?ú6M), Bellamy (?ú6M), Skrtl (?ú6M) and Agger (?ú5.8M). He was very close to putting together a brilliant team: Reina, X, Skrtl, Agger, X, Mascherano, Alonso, X, X, Gerrard, Torres.
